ASIGNATURA: TEORÍA Y ADMINISTRACIÓN DE BASE DE DATOS

 

TRABAJO 3 

DIAGRAMA DE ESTRUCTURA DE DATOS

 

 

Entre otras de las técnicas utilizadas para la construcción del modelo conceptual se tiene el Diagrama de Estructura de datos.

                                                                          

La  diferencia  entre  el modelo Entidad-Relación y el Diagrama de Estructura de datos, es la existencia en el Modelo Entidad-Relación de relaciones N-ARIAS, permitiendo ser un modelo cercano a la representación del mundo real, recomendable  para  representar el modelo de información  del sistema a muy alto nivel. El Modelo Entidad-Relación, es un modelo N-ARIO (entre N entidades simultáneamente),  que  permite  relacionar  una,  dos o más entidades, y el Diagrama de Estructura de datos, permite  representar  gráficamente las relaciones o asociaciones entre pares de entidades.                                                                                                                                    

 

Descripción del diagrama de estructura de datos

                                                                      

Para la construcción del diagrama de estructura de datos, necesitamos los siguientes elementos: entidades, relaciones.

 

Entidad: Objeto (persona, lugar o cosa) sobre la  cual la organización captura, almacena o procesa datos.  Su  representación grafica es un rectángulo

 

Relación: Es la conexión que va existir (entre tipos de entidades). Su representación grafica es una línea recta.

 

Las fases para la construcción de la estructura de datos son similares a las fases utilizadas para el diseño del modelo Entidad-Relación:

                                                           

v            Identificar las entidades dentro del Sistema,  teniendo  previo conocimiento del funcionamiento del sistema.

 

v            Determinar  las  claves  o identificadores de las entidades.

 

v            Establecer las relaciones entre las entidades.

 

v            Dibujar el modelo de datos.

 

v            Identificar y describir los atributos de cada entidad, teniendo en cuenta todas  las  propiedades de cada entidad en las que el sistema tenga interés.

 

v            Verificaciones, se realizaran sobre el diagrama, eliminando las relaciones redundantes. Una relación o asociación puede ser  redundante si puede expresarse  exactamente  por medio de una combinación de varias asociaciones.

 

 

Diagrama de Estructura de Datos para el Control y Registro del Personal Docente

 

El diagrama nos representa gráficamente las relaciones o asociaciones entre pares de entidades del Personal Docente del Instituto Pedagógico Rural “Gervasio Rubio

 

DOCENTE PERTENECE DEPARTAMENTO

 

 

 

 

 

 

 


                                                                     

  

La entidad DOCENTE y DEPARTAMENTO con la relación PERTENECE, se relacionan por medio del Código de departamento, donde cada entidad tiene los siguientes atributos:

   

DOCENTE

DEPARTAMENTO

Código de Docente (clave principal)

Código_del_departamento (clave principal)

Cedula _de_ Identidad

Nombre_del_departamento

Nombre

Lugar del departamento

Apellido

 

Sexo

 

Dirección (numero de casa, calle, sector, ciudad)

 

Fecha nacimiento

 

Edad

 

Teléfono

 

Correo electrónico

 

Código_del_departamento (clave externa) relacion

 

 

 

La entidad Docente además de sus atributos que permiten identificarla se le asigna el atributo Código del departamento, este atributo es clave principal de la entidad Departamento y por medio de el se relacionan ambas entidades, por lo que cada Docente posee el código de departamento al que pertenece.

 

DOCENTE DIRIGE DEPARTAMENTO

 

 

 

 

 


La entidad DOCENTE y DEPARTAMENTO con la relacion DIRIGE, se relacionan por medio del Código de Docente, donde cada entidad tiene los siguientes atributos:

 

DOCENTE

DEPARTAMENTO

Código de Docente (clave principal)

Código_del_departamento (clave principal)

Cedula _de_ Identidad

Nombre_del_departamento

Nombre

Lugar del departamento

Apellido

Código de Docente (clave externa) relacion

Sexo

 

Dirección (numero de casa, calle, sector, ciudad)

 

Fecha nacimiento

 

Edad

 

Teléfono

 

Correo electrónico

 

 

 

La Entidad Departamento además de poseer los atributos Código de departamento, Nombre de departamento, Lugar de departamento, se le asigna el atributo Código de Docente que dirige a cada uno de los departamentos, atributo que establece la relacion entre ambas entidades.

 

 

DOCENTE TIENE CATEGORIA

 

 

 

 

 


La entidad DOCENTE y CATEGORIA con la relacion TIENE, se relacionan por medio del Código de docente, donde cada entidad tiene los siguientes atributos:

 

DOCENTE

CATEGORIA

Código de Docente (clave principal)

Id categoría

Cedula _de_ Identidad

Categoría del docente

Nombre

Dedicación del docente

Apellido

Carga académica

Sexo

Condición del docente

Dirección (numero de casa, calle, sector, ciudad)

Asignatura que imparte

Fecha nacimiento

Grado universitario

Edad

Código de docente (clave externa) Relación

Teléfono

 

Correo electrónico

 

La entidad Categoría se le asigna el atributo Código de docente, este atributo es clave principal de la entidad Docente y por medio de este atributo se relacionan ambas entidades, por lo que cada Categoría posee el código de docente al que pertenece.

 

DEPARTAMENTO TIENE CATEGORIA

 

 

 

 

 


La entidad DEPARTAMENTO y CATEGORIA con la relacion TIENE, por medio del Código de departamento se relacionan ambas entidades, donde cada entidad tiene los siguientes atributos:

 

DEPARTAMENTO

CATEGORIA

Código_del_departamento (clave principal)

Id categoría (clave principal)

Nombre_del_departamento

Categoría del docente

Lugar del departamento

Dedicación del docente

 

Carga académica

Condición del docente

Asignatura que imparte

Grado universitario

Código_de_departamento (clave externa) Relacion

 

 

La entidad Categoría se le asigna el campo Código de departamento, este atributo es clave principal de la entidad Departamento y por medio de este atributo se relacionan ambas entidades, por lo que cada Categoría de los docente posee el código departamento al que pertenece cada docente con su categoría.

 

 

DOCENTE TIENE PAGO DE NOMINA

 

 

 

 

 


La entidad DOCENTE y PAGO DE NOMINA con la relacion TIENE, se relacionan por medio del Código de docente ambas entidades, donde cada entidad tiene los siguientes atributos:

 

DOCENTE

PAGO DE NOMINA

Código de Docente (clave principal)

Id nomina (clave principal)

Cedula _de_ Identidad

Salario

Nombre

Nombre de la asignación

Apellido

Nombre de la deducción

Sexo

Monto o porcentaje de asignación

Dirección (numero de casa, calle, sector, ciudad)

Monto o porcentaje de deducción

Fecha nacimiento

Salario final                               

Edad

Código de docente (clave externa) Relación

Teléfono

 

Correo electrónico

 

 

 

 

La entidad Pago de Nomina se le asigna el campo Código de docente, este atributo es clave principal de la entidad Docente y por medio de este atributo se relacionan ambas entidades, por lo que cada Pago de Nomina de los docente posee el código docente al que se va a realizar el pago.

 

Hosted by www.Geocities.ws

1